Introduction to Infrared Light Price in the Industry

Infrared Light Price: Understanding the Market Dynamics

The world of infrared light technology has seen significant advancements in recent years, with applications ranging from medical diagnostics to industrial automation. One of the critical aspects of this industry is the price of infrared light, which can vary widely depending on the technology, quality, and intended use. This article delves into the factors influencing infrared light price and explores the market dynamics that shape this dynamic industry.

1. Types of Infrared Light Technology

Infrared light technology encompasses a broad spectrum of devices and systems, each with its own set of specifications and price points. Here are some of the common types of infrared light technology: - Thermal Imaging Cameras: These cameras use infrared light to detect heat and are widely used in security, building inspection, and medical diagnostics. The price of thermal imaging cameras can range from a few hundred dollars for consumer-grade models to tens of thousands of dollars for professional-grade equipment. - Infrared Sensors: These sensors are used in a variety of applications, including temperature measurement, motion detection, and remote controls. The price of infrared sensors can vary from a few dollars for basic models to several hundred dollars for high-precision sensors. - Infrared Lamps and Luminaires: These are used for heating, illumination, and other applications. The price of infrared lamps can range from a few dollars for simple bulbs to several hundred dollars for specialized luminaires. - Infrared Detectors: These devices are used to detect infrared radiation and are crucial in applications such as remote sensing and security systems. The price of infrared detectors can vary significantly based on their sensitivity, accuracy, and the technology used.

2. Factors Influencing Infrared Light Price

Several factors contribute to the price of infrared light technology: - Technology Complexity: More advanced technologies, such as uncooled microbolometers used in thermal imaging cameras, tend to be more expensive due to their complexity and precision. - Quality and Reliability: High-quality components and rigorous testing lead to higher prices but also ensure longer lifespan and better performance. - Brand and Reputation: Established brands with a reputation for quality and reliability often command higher prices than generic or less-known brands. - Market Demand: The demand for certain types of infrared light technology can drive prices up or down. For example, demand for thermal imaging cameras has surged due to their use in the COVID-19 pandemic for fever detection. - Volume of Production: Bulk production can lead to lower prices due to economies of scale, while limited production runs can result in higher prices. - Regulatory Compliance: Compliance with international standards and regulations can add to the cost of infrared light technology.

3. Market Trends

The infrared light market is influenced by several trends: - Integration with IoT: The Internet of Things (IoT) is driving the integration of infrared technology with other smart devices, leading to new applications and potentially higher prices for integrated solutions. - Environmental Concerns: As the world becomes more environmentally conscious, there is a growing demand for energy-efficient infrared light solutions, which can influence pricing. - Healthcare Innovations: The healthcare sector is a significant driver of infrared light technology demand, particularly in areas like diagnostics and patient monitoring. - Security and Surveillance: The need for advanced security systems is increasing, which is fueling the demand for high-quality infrared sensors and cameras.

4. Future Outlook

The future of the infrared light industry looks promising, with several potential developments: - Miniaturization: As technology advances, infrared devices are becoming smaller and more portable, which could lead to lower prices and wider adoption. - Cost Reduction: Innovations in manufacturing processes and materials could lead to cost reductions in infrared light technology. - New Applications: The discovery of new applications for infrared light could open up new markets and drive demand. In conclusion, the infrared light price is a multifaceted aspect of the industry, influenced by a range of factors including technology complexity, quality, market demand, and regulatory compliance. As the industry continues to evolve, understanding these dynamics is crucial for stakeholders looking to invest in or navigate the infrared light market.
